Price for Processed Petroleum Oils and Distillates in Brazil (CIF) - 2023
The average import price for processed petroleum oils and distillates stood at $894 per ton in September 2023, with an increase of 5.3% against the previous month. In general, the import price, however, recorded a mild decline.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in August 2023 when the average import price increased by 11% m-o-m. The import price peaked at $1,098 per ton in October 2022; however, from November 2022 to September 2023, import prices stood at a somewhat lower figure.
Prices varied noticeably by the country of origin: the country with the highest price was India ($1,211 per ton), while the price for Peru ($707 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From September 2022 to September 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Russia (+2.2%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
Price for Processed Petroleum Oils and Distillates in Brazil (FOB) - 2023
The average export price for processed petroleum oils and distillates stood at $688 per ton in September 2023, growing by 14% against the previous month. Over the period under review, the export price, however, saw a slight reduction.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in June 2023 an increase of 17% month-to-month. Over the period under review, the average export prices reached the maximum at $794 per ton in September 2022; however, from October 2022 to September 2023, the export prices failed to regain momentum.
There were significant differences in the average prices for the major foreign markets. In September 2023, the country with the highest price was Argentina ($1,293 per ton), while the average price for exports to Singapore ($588 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From September 2022 to September 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Spain (+5.0%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
Imports of Processed Petroleum Oils and Distillates in Brazil
In 2022, imports of processed petroleum oils and distillates into Brazil soared to 69M tons, growing by 77% on the previous year's figure. In general, imports saw a significant expansion. As a result, imports reached the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
In value terms, processed petroleum oils and distillates imports soared to $24.2B in 2022. Overall, imports showed significant growth. As a result, imports reached the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
Import of Processed Petroleum Oils and Distillates in Brazil (Billion US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| CAGR, 2019-2022 |
United States | 7.5 | 5.9 | 8.7 | 13.5 | 21.6% |
India | 0.4 | 0.1 | 1.1 | 5.3 | 136.6% |
Netherlands | 0.7 | 0.3 | 0.6 | 1.3 | 22.9% |
Spain | 0.4 | 0.3 | 0.4 | 0.6 | 14.5% |
Others | 2.5 | 1.2 | 2.9 | 3.5 | 11.9% |
Total | 11.5 | 7.8 | 13.7 | 24.2 | 28.1% |
Top Suppliers of Processed Petroleum Oils and Distillates to Brazil in 2022:
- United States (43.3M tons)
- India (11.5M tons)
- Netherlands (3.5M tons)
- Spain (1.8M tons)
Exports of Processed Petroleum Oils and Distillates in Brazil
For the fourth year in a row, Brazil recorded growth in shipments abroad of processed petroleum oils and distillates, which increased by 20% to 17M tons in 2022. Over the period under review, total exports indicated a resilient increase from 2019 to 2022: its volume increased at an average annual rate of +13.1% over the last three years.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2022 figures, exports increased by +44.7% against 2019 indices. As a result, the exports attained the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
In value terms, processed petroleum oils and distillates exports soared to $13B in 2022. Overall, exports continue to indicate a significant expansion. As a result, the exports reached the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
